Background
The parties are engaged in divorce proceedings. During pre-trial conferences, the plaintiff sought to separate divorce issues from matrimonial property division. The defendant raised objections about procedural readiness, including non-service of an alleged adulteress and incomplete discovery of company shareholding details.
